What’s National Couple Appreciation Month?

Not to be confused with National Couples Day, National Couple Appreciation Month is an April holiday that reminds us to appreciate our partner and their presence in our lives.

First time hearing about this? You’re not alone.

According to the website Days of the Year, the holiday was invented by a travel agency called Blissful Escapes, back in 2010.

According to them, they created the holiday in order to “encourage couples to do something special to reinforce and celebrate their relationship.”

Spend Quality Time Together

Ask any psychiatrist and they’ll tell you spending quality time together is vital for any relationship. The keyword here is quality, not quantity.

According to the website Very Well Mind, “Every couple needs quality time together in order for the relationship to grow and to develop.”

When you’re with your partner, it’s important to put your phone down and focus on them. It’s all about expressing your love and affection with your undivided attention.

When you do that, it touches their hearts because it says their presence matters more to you than the smartphone in your hand.

To give your partner the quality time they deserve, take note to:

  • Make eye contact. Doing so implies giving your partner your full attention which will make them feel important.

  • Use active listening skills. Make an effort to understand what they’re saying. Sometimes your partner is just looking for empathy and compassion.

  • Set limits on technology. Make it a habit to put your phone away while you’re in a conversation with your partner. Carve out a few minutes of your time for a meaningful and uninterrupted conversation.

  • Focus on quality, not quantity. Even if it’s just drinking coffee together or sitting on the couch, the quality of time you spend together is more meaningful and special.

  • Be present and available. When your partner feels insecure or is having a bad day, be there for them when they need it. By doing so, you are able to demonstrate that you are present and available when they need you.

Quality time is all about how you spend your time together with your partner. No matter what activities you both do together if you’re attentive and focused, your partner will feel loved.
